Evaluating Random Input Generation Strategies for Accessibility Testing

Diogo Santos, Vinicius Durelli, Andre Endo, Marcelo Eler

2021

Abstract

Mobile accessibility testing is the process of checking whether a mobile app can be perceived, understood, and operated by a wide range of users. Accessibility testing tools can support this activity by automatically generating user inputs to navigate through the app under evaluation and run accessibility checks in each new discovered screen. The algorithm that determines which user input will be generated to simulate the user interaction plays a pivotal role in such an approach. In the state of the art approaches, a Uniform Random algorithm is usually employed. In this paper, we compared the results of the default algorithm implemented by a state of the art tool with four different biased random strategies taking into account the number of activities executed, screen states traversed, and accessibility violations revealed. Our results show that the default algorithm had the worst performance while the algorithm biased towards different weights assigned to specific actions and widgets had the best performance.

Download


Paper Citation


in Harvard Style

Santos D., Durelli V., Endo A. and Eler M. (2021). Evaluating Random Input Generation Strategies for Accessibility Testing. In Proceedings of the 23rd International Conference on Enterprise Information Systems - Volume 2: ICEIS, ISBN 978-989-758-509-8, pages 66-75. DOI: 10.5220/0010456100660075


in Bibtex Style

@conference{iceis21,
author={Diogo Santos and Vinicius Durelli and Andre Endo and Marcelo Eler},
title={Evaluating Random Input Generation Strategies for Accessibility Testing},
booktitle={Proceedings of the 23rd International Conference on Enterprise Information Systems - Volume 2: ICEIS,},
year={2021},
pages={66-75},
publisher={SciTePress},
organization={INSTICC},
doi={10.5220/0010456100660075},
isbn={978-989-758-509-8},
}


in EndNote Style

TY - CONF

JO - Proceedings of the 23rd International Conference on Enterprise Information Systems - Volume 2: ICEIS,
TI - Evaluating Random Input Generation Strategies for Accessibility Testing
SN - 978-989-758-509-8
AU - Santos D.
AU - Durelli V.
AU - Endo A.
AU - Eler M.
PY - 2021
SP - 66
EP - 75
DO - 10.5220/0010456100660075